What is VA SAH grant?

What is VA SAH grant?

The Specially Adapted Housing (SAH) program offers grants to service members and Veterans with certain severe service-connected disabilities. The grants assist with building, remodeling or purchasing an adapted home.

How does VA SAH grant work?

The VA makes SAH grants for up to 50% of the total cost of the home, and to a maximum of $100,896 per fiscal year, whichever is less. The VA recognizes that home values can change, and grant limits can increase. So the law allows for the SAH grant benefits to be used as many as three times by one eligible veteran.

How much is the VA Hisa grant?

HISA grants can total up to $6,800 over the veteran’s lifetime. This dollar amount is current in FY 2020 and is listed for reference only–the amounts you qualify for may be different. HISA Grants up to the maximum may be approved for: Veterans/Servicemembers with VA-rated service connected conditions.

How much is the VA automobile grant?

The Department of Veterans Affairs’ automobile grant increased to a maximum of $21,488.29 effective Oct. 1 for fiscal 2020. The fiscal 2019 maximum amount was $21,058.69.

How do I get a VA grant?

By mail. Fill out an Application in Acquiring Specially Adapted Housing or Special Home Adaptation Grant (VA Form 26-4555). Mail the completed application to your nearest regional loan center. What can a HISA grant be used for?

Home Improvement and Structural Alteration – HISA Grant HISA Grants offer financial resources to disabled veterans to make medically necessary modifications to their homes to improve access, mobility, and in particular, to facilitate use of the lavatory facilities.

Can a veteran get a special adapted housing grant?

If you are a Servicemember or Veteran with a permanent and total service-connected disability, you may be entitled to a Specially Adapted Housing (SAH) grant or a Special Housing Adaptation (SHA) grant.

Can a TRA grant be used for SAH?

A temporary grant may be available to SAH/SHA eligible Veterans and Servicemembers who are or will be temporarily residing in a home owned by a family member. The TRA grant will not be deducted from the total grant funds available to a Veteran or Servicemember
